Transcript


All right, let's start at the beginning. What's an MCP? Sounds good. So MCP stands for Model Context Protocol. A little over a year ago, Anthropic open-sourced this protocol that they were starting to use internally. So it was a way for them to kind of standardize the way your models and your data integrated to make AI agent building more seamless, make it easy to discover what tools are available. Now there's a standard integration, which did nothing other than accelerate the pace at which AI is happening. Now all of a sudden, there's a standard way to connect. Summary

This short explainer from Nutanix's 'I/O You an Explanation' series breaks down Model Context Protocol (MCP), the open-source standard originally developed and used internally by Anthropic before being released to the broader developer community roughly a year ago. MCP defines a standardized way for AI models to connect with data sources and external tools, removing the friction that previously made building AI agents complex and inconsistent. By establishing a common integration layer, MCP makes it significantly easier for developers to discover available tools and wire them into AI workflows without custom, one-off connectors. The core argument presented is that standardization is the primary accelerant for AI agent development — once there is a universal way to connect models to data, the pace of innovation compounds rapidly. The video positions MCP not as a niche technical specification but as a foundational shift in how AI systems are built and extended, framing it as a key enabler for the next wave of enterprise AI adoption.

FAQ

What problem does MCP solve for AI developers?

Before MCP, connecting AI models to different data sources and tools required custom, non-standardized integrations for each use case. MCP provides a single, universal protocol so developers can discover available tools and connect models to data in a consistent way, making AI agent development faster and more scalable.

Who created MCP and is it open source?

MCP was created by Anthropic, who initially used it as an internal standard. Approximately a year ago, Anthropic open-sourced the protocol, making it available for the broader AI development community to adopt and build upon.
